Cricket fans in India will now have to pay more to watch IPL matches live, after the government raised the GST on premium sporting events from 28% to 40%. A ticket that previously cost Rs 1,000 plus ...
The new tax rate is uniform across IPL and other high-value sporting events, lumping them in with sectors traditionally considered non-essential or luxury.
The final ticket prize for an IPL match, which has a base prize of Rs 1,000, will now be upto Rs 1,280-1,400, as per ESPNCricinfo. This raise puts the IPL in India's highest GST bracket, alongside ...
